following a link (URL) on a checked out item
- gives a error 500 - an error has occured

It needs to stay on the same page and give error message
OR
for the error 500 we need something like
"access denied - this item has been checked out by $user->username"

SUGGESTIONS:
- a url link on a checked out item perhaps needs a css class of fly so that the details are visable but not clickable
- maybe a checked out item could be "greyed out" an alternate background colour to define checked out items

A little tip in the grid :
$row->params->get('tag-checkedout');

Will tell you if the item is checked out.

This is defined in populateState() from classes/jmodel.list.php
